Five Reasons Why Life Is Truly Beautiful

We are, at times, so consumed with our day to day lives that we may even forget how beautiful life really is

260
Five Reasons Why Life Is Truly Beautiful
HighViewArt

On this road we call life, as cliche as it may sound, we often find ourselves losing our way. At times we close ourselves off from the world, forgetting the essence of happiness, and lose our passion for life and all it has in store for us in the process. We may become so enamored with our schedules, so focused on what we should do, that we just about forget what it is that makes life so great. To remind those who may need an optimistic outlook, here are five reasons why life is truly beautiful:

1. Life Is Spontaneous

People tend to adhere so closely to their day to day schedule that they forget how spontaneous life really is. It may be a typical school or work morning. You are ready to make the commute, when suddenly, a clap of thunder halts your objective. The clouds didn't think about what it is you had to do that day. This may be a difficult thing to appreciate, but when you think about it, if today you can be met with the worst news without warning, you can also be met with the best. We will never know what will happen in the next day, hour, or even second of our lives. Knowing this allows us to appreciate the present; thus, giving us a chance to be guided by whatever life has in store for us, without constantly worrying about the future or losing hope when things seem to become too repetitive.

2. Life Is Fleeting

To know life is fleeting is probably fearful for many; however, it is also a good way to remind us to live life to its fullest. I'm not going to quote any sort of modern motto from a certain popular rap song, but it is a true statement nonetheless. We are unsure of what it is that happens after our deaths, so it is best to just assume that we must do everything that makes us happy. This isn't exactly a mantra for recklessness, just motivating words for those who feel that life is either too long or worrisome. Our lives are terminal, so why not know how our stories play out until the very end? The fact that life doesn't last forever makes it all the more necessary to cherish.

3. Life is Mysterious

When it comes to things we know about life and the universe, we know practically nothing. Within our lifetime, we come to understand how shrouded in mystery our past truly is. Even more so, we do not know much about our purpose, surroundings, and the outlook of our species. Since we are curious by nature, there is nothing more satisfying than knowing there is so much more to discover. We may feel that we have seen and heard it all, but as soon as we achieve a meta-cognitive state, we begin to look at things a bit differently. The world shows much promise, even more so than we tend realize.

4. Life Is Wondrous

In our every day lives we may forget about all of the wonders of this world. We may not be as interested, or rather, not as convinced that life is wondrous at all. Even if we do tend to forget this truth, it is still never too late to immerse yourself in the beautiful opportunities that life has to offer. It could be as simple as seeing the Niagara Falls, or as daring as experiencing a road-trip with your friends. At some point, we will all find that one thing that makes us stare at the world in awe.

5. Life Is Conformable

Everyone is greatly affected by the passage of time, physically or mentally. However, at one time or another, we must take ourselves out of the loop of order and do things spontaneously as well. We can't always rely on the irregularities of life. Even if our lives are finite, we shouldn't be too distressed by time itself, always thinking we must get one thing done by noon and another by 6 p.m. By acknowledging this, we can sit back and take a breather. We don't have to work at that place, we don't have to talk to that person, we don't have to live in this town forever. Realize that we are capable of changing things as individuals, even if life is always changing in itself. In short, life, at times, is really what you make it.

These beautiful aspects of life are but some of many. By reminding ourselves of the fact, we may begin to look at life quite differently. During all of my times of despair, I always needed to be reminded of some of the simplest things in order to gain the motivation to change my attitude and keep appreciating life for what it is.
